Forum: Plugins
In reply to: [Testimonials Widget] Filter by categories not working with GutenbergFurther. This (and the preg_match bug reported earlier) appears to be something to do with the version of PHP. On my live server I have PHP 7.1.27 and on my test server I have 7.3.1
It looks like something has changed with preg_match between these two versions of PHP which means this plugin no longer works properly.
